微创主动脉瓣置换术中连续逆行心脏停搏液的安全性和适用性:新方法。

Safety and Applicability of Continuous Retrograde Cardioplegia in Minimally Invasive Aortic Valve Replacement: New Approaches.

机构信息

Department of Cardiovascular Surgery, Yodogawa Christian Hospital, Osaka, Osaka, Japan.

Department of Cardiovascular Surgery, Kobe University Graduate School of Medicine, Kobe, Hyogo, Japan.

出版信息

Ann Thorac Cardiovasc Surg. 2022 Feb 20;28(1):36-40. doi: 10.5761/atcs.nm.20-00293. Epub 2021 Aug 4.

DOI:10.5761/atcs.nm.20-00293
PMID:34349073
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C8915936/
Abstract

PURPOSE

To discuss minimally invasive cardiac surgery aortic valve replacement (MICS-AVR) approach via anterior thoracotomy using continuous retrograde cardioplegia. Continuous retrograde cardioplegia facilitates excellent continuous homogeneous cooling of the heart during cardiac arrest.

METHODS

We performed AVR using the proposed method in nine patients between June 2018 and September 2019. The median age of the patients was 73 (range: 43-84) years. The pleural space was entered via anterior thoracotomy. After opening of the right atrium, a retrograde cardioplegic cannula was inserted into the coronary sinus with a purse-string suture. Continuous cold blood retrograde cardioplegia was initiated at 700 mL/h.

RESULTS

Extubation in the operating room was performed in five (56%) patients. No new decreased function of the left and right ventricles was observed in intraoperative transesophageal echography or transthoracic echocardiogram.

CONCLUSION

MICA-AVR through continuous retrograde cardioplegia is a safe technique.

摘要

目的

讨论经前胸壁切口采用持续逆行心脏停搏液灌注的微创心脏外科主动脉瓣置换术(MICS-AVR)方法。持续逆行心脏停搏液可在心脏停搏期间实现心脏的出色、均匀的持续冷却。

方法

我们在 2018 年 6 月至 2019 年 9 月期间对 9 例患者使用提出的方法进行了 AVR。患者的中位年龄为 73 岁(范围:43-84 岁)。经前胸壁切口进入胸腔。打开右心房后,用荷包缝线将逆行灌流管插入冠状窦。以 700 mL/h 的速度开始持续冷血逆行心脏停搏液灌注。

结果

5 例(56%)患者在手术室拔管。术中经食管超声心动图或经胸超声心动图未观察到左、右心室新出现功能减退。

结论

通过持续逆行心脏停搏液的 MICA-AVR 是一种安全的技术。
